1 PRELIMINARY PROGRAMME Horn of Africa Conference - Vll Faith, Citizenship, Democracy and Peace In the Horn Africa 17 th - 19 th October 2008, Lund, Sweden Sudan Somalia Ethiopia Eritrea Djibouti Objectives: INFORMATION The overall objective of the conference is to explore ideas by bringing together religious leaders, civics, scholars, practitioners, political leaders, government representatives to share their experience and critical examine how harmonious relationships can be built between different ethnic and religious groups in order to promote democracy and peace. The purpose of the conference is to enhance the capacity of stakeholders in the Horn of Africa as well as academics with new ideas and tools to enable them to act progressively and effectively in favor of promoting democracy, peace and development in the Horn of Africa societies. Further, we hope that mutual dialogue between learned people of various faiths in the region will enhance their collective capacities to reshape the fortunes of the people of the region and enhance the prospects for peace and democratic order. The primary objective of the conference is to: - Identify key characteristics of syncretic religious processes to build democracy and peace in the Horn of Africa. - Raise awareness of contentious issues for long-term development. - Encourage and facilitate dialogue between stakeholders to stimulate community-driven solutions integrated with long-term development plans. - Enable networking among stakeholders such as religious leaders, scholars, civil society and political leaders on peace-building issues. - Assess the impact of the war on terrorism on the radicalization and politicization of religion on the Horn of Africa. The conference will be held in an internationally and culturally known University City of Lund, Sweden. All papers presented, workshops and panel debates will be in English and proceedings of the conference will be published as a book after the conference. Free entrance and it is open to all! 1
